Aligning Sensors
Alignment can be used to compensate for mounting inaccuracies by aligning sensor data to a common
reference surface (often a conveyor belt).
To prepare for alignment:
1.
Choose an alignment reference in the
Manage
page if you have not already done so.
on page 73 for more information.
2.
Go to the
Scan
page.
3.
Choose Profile or Surface mode in the
Scan Mode
panel, depending on the type of measurement
whose decision you need to configure.
If one of these modes is not selected, tools will not be available in the
Measure
panel.
4.
Expand the
Alignment
panel by clicking on the panel header or the
button.
5.
Ensure that all sensors have a clear view of the target surface.
Remove any irregular objects from the sensor's field of view that might interfere with alignment. If
using a bar for a dual-sensor system, ensure that the lasers illuminate a reference hole on the bar.
